Rado watches are known for their innovative design, high quality materials, and precision timekeeping. Founded in Switzerland in 1917, Rado has built a reputation for creating watches that are not only stylish but also incredibly durable.

One of the key features of Rado watches is their use of high-tech materials like ceramic, sapphire crystal, and titanium. Ceramic is particularly popular due to its scratch-resistant properties and ability to maintain its lustre over time. Rado was one of the first watchmakers to use ceramic in their wristwatches, setting a trend that many other brands have since followed.

In addition to their use of cutting-edge materials, Rado watches are also known for their minimalist yet striking design. The brand has a signature aesthetic that is sleek, sophisticated, and modern. Many of their timepieces feature clean lines, simple dials, and a monochromatic colour palette, making them versatile enough to complement a wide range of styles.

Rado watches are also renowned for their precision timekeeping. The brand uses Swiss-made movements in all of their watches, ensuring that they are accurate and reliable. Whether you’re looking for a simple everyday watch or a more complicated chronograph, Rado has a timepiece to suit your needs.
